MPSCDRC, Bhopal - Consumer Complaint no. 49 of 2016 - Eid Mohd. vs National Ins. Co. Ltd. -
Consumer complaint filed by Eid Mohd. alleged that insured truck was stolen, which FIR was lodged under Section 379 IPC with PS Pipalrawan, Dewas at crime No.301/14 dated 22/09/2014. Insurance claim denied by company as in investigation the FIR of insured truck lodged at crime No. 301/14 dated 22/09/2014 at PS Pipalrawan, Dewas, was forged.
In Complaint case Insurance Company taken defense accordingly and filed PS Pipalrawan RTI certified copy of Original FIR lodged by Rameshchand for theft of 5 HP submersible motor pump at crime no. 301/14 dated 04/11/2014 and also raised preliminary objection regarding false complaint case and dismiss it at initial stage.
After that Complainant also filed SP, Dewas RTI certified copy of FIR crime no. 301/14 dated 22/09/2014, thereafter insurance company verified the Complainant’s RTI certified copy which again found forged.
The FIR lodged by complainant and the FIR lodged by Rameshchand were totally inconsistent and ran counter to each other, therefore Hon’ble Commission by order dated 18.4.2017 directed SP, Dewas to hold an enquiry and place before the Commission genuine and correct FIR in respect of crime No.301/14 of PS, Pipalrawan, Disrict Dewas.
In response to above direction, an enquiry was held by DSP HQ/Traffic, Dewas and report dated 29.1.2018 was submitted before Hon’ble Commission. According to report the FIR lodged by the complainant on 13.8.2014, crime No.301/14 under Section 379 IPC was registered on 22.9.2014, but the said FIR was not found in PS, Pipalrava. Said FIR purports to have been recorded on page No.46 in FIR book No. 1492, but this FIR book did not belong to PS, Pipalrava. During enquiry an information was sought from Record Branch of D.P.O. Dewas about distribution of book No. 1492, whereupon it was found that in the period between years 2006 to 2016, no book having No.1492 was distributed in Dewas. It was further found that book No. 1492 was not at all printed by the Deputy Controller of Regional Press, Gwalior, Bhopal and Indore. It has been mentioned in the enquiry report that signatures of Inspector Bhadoria on the FIR presented by Eid Mohammed are doubtful. After making other enquiries and recording statements of concerned persons the Enquiry Officer/Deputy Superintendent of Police, reported that the copy of alleged FIR produced by the complainant regarding theft of his truck was forged/fabricated. It could be possible that for obtaining false claim the story of theft of truck was concocted and documents were fabricated.
On the basis of enquiry report Hon’ble Commission allowed preliminary objection and dismissed the complaint.
